AP Physics FAQ

What topics are covered in AP Physics tutoring?

AP Physics tutoring covers a range of topics that may include kinematics, Newton's laws of motion, work, energy and power, systems of particles, linear momentum, circular motion and rotation, oscillations and gravitation, electrostatics, conductors, capacitors, electric circuits, magnetic fields, electromagnetism, optics, and quantum, atomic, and nuclear physics. The exact topics can vary depending on whether the tutoring is for AP Physics 1, 2, or C.

How can AP Physics tutoring help improve my grade?

AP Physics tutoring can help improve your grade by providing personalized instruction tailored to your learning style, addressing specific areas of difficulty, offering practice problems and exam strategies, reinforcing key concepts, and building a strong foundation in the principles and applications of physics. This targeted support can boost understanding and performance both in coursework and on the AP exam.

Is AP Physics tutoring worth it for college credit?

AP Physics tutoring can be worth it for those aiming to earn college credit as it prepares students to perform well on the AP exam. A high score may provide college credit or advanced placement in university courses, potentially saving time and tuition costs. However, individual value may depend on the college's AP credit policy and the student's academic goals.

What is the difference between AP Physics 1 and AP Physics C tutoring?

AP Physics 1 tutoring typically focuses on the fundamentals of physics, covering topics in mechanics and basic concepts without calculus. AP Physics C tutoring is designed for students with a stronger math background and covers mechanics and electricity and magnetism with a calculus-based approach, providing a more in-depth and rigorous study of physics designed to match introductory college courses for majors in physical sciences or engineering.

How often should I meet with an AP Physics tutor?

The frequency of meeting with an AP Physics tutor depends on your individual needs, academic goals, and schedule. Some students may need weekly sessions for consistent support, while others may benefit from bi-weekly or even on-demand sessions prior to exams or when tackling challenging topics. It's best to assess your understanding of the material and plan sessions accordingly.

About AP Physics & AP Physics Tutoring

AP Physics: Fostering a Deeper Understanding of the Physical World

Advanced Placement (AP) Physics refers to college-level physics courses and exams offered by high schools in partnership with the College Board in the United States and Canada. Designed to simulate a college physics program, AP Physics seeks to provide high school students with a foundation in the principles and applications of physics before they embark on higher education. By taking this course, students can earn college credits, skip introductory courses in college, or fulfill general education requirements, depending on the policies of the institution they attend.

There are multiple types of AP Physics courses available, each exploring different areas of physics. AP Physics 1 covers classical mechanics, waves, and basic electrical circuits, and is algebra-based, making it more accessible to students without a strong mathematics background. AP Physics 2 continues with fluid mechanics, thermodynamics, electricity and magnetism, optics, and topics in modern physics. Like AP Physics 1, it is also algebra-based. On the more rigorous side, AP Physics C is divided into two parts: Mechanics and Electricity and Magnetism. These courses are calculus-based and require students to apply differential and integral calculus in their solutions to physics problems.

Entities related to AP Physics include the College Board, which administers the AP program, as well as high schools that provide these courses, and colleges that recognize the AP credits. Standardized testing organizations and educational material publishers are also involved by providing resources such as practice tests and study aids for students.

Tutoring someone struggling with AP Physics involves a strategy that enhances conceptual understanding while developing problem-solving skills. Effective tutoring means first ensuring a foundational grasp of algebra and trigonometry, which are critical for solving physics problems. Tutors should encourage active learning through questioning and allow students to work through problems independently before giving a detailed explanation. Interactive demonstrations, using both real-world experiments and computer simulations, can be particularly helpful in illustrating abstract concepts. Moreover, relating physics concepts to everyday experiences can make the material more tangible. Consistent practice and review sessions aimed at both conceptual questions and complex numerical problems prepare the student for the format and rigor of the AP exams. Peer study groups and online resources can also provide additional support.

The most common concepts in AP Physics revolve around Newton's laws of motion, energy conservation, momentum, wave behavior, and basic electrical circuits. Students often find topics such as rotational motion, electromagnetism, and fluids more challenging due to the complexity and abstract nature of the concepts, as well as the integration of more advanced mathematics. The difficulty of these concepts can be mitigated by a structured approach to the course that breaks down each topic into small, manageable pieces, reinforcing them through both practice and contextual understanding.

Overall, success in AP Physics isn't solely about mastering the content; it's also about developing critical thinking and applying mathematical concepts. A holistic tutoring approach that emphasizes both theory and practical problem-solving can help students succeed not only in their AP exams but in future scientific endeavors.
